Transaction 515f62e4c69eb6b0014582643bb1d8b15cf11745cc8f5bb30fcfcbdf6094286a
1 Input
1 Output
-
515f62e4c69eb6b0014582643bb1d8b15cf11745cc8f5bb30fcfcbdf6094286a:0
- value
- 252668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cdd31778d11e8e510b2828910c817f15dc33b24 OP_EQUAL
- address
- 3EXqWB7HES3cHdDNmz2fA73bbqy3xeR5UT